0

我有一个代码,当我克隆该代码时,会发现更少的值可以自行重置。它与 appendTo() 函数一起使用,但我想将 appendTo 用于多个 div
例如:

<div id="allocationId"><select><option value="">Select</option><option value="A" selected>A</option></div>
<div id="modalDiv"></div>
<div id="tmpDiv"></div>

我想将在 allocationId 中定义的代码附加到 modalDiv 和 tmpDiv 不起作用的
代码:

$('#allocationId').find('select').clone().appendTo('#tmpDiv')
//Another Code that don't works  
$('#allocationId').find('select').appendTo('#tmpDiv #modalDiv')
//Code that works but its just for only one div  
$('#allocationId').find('select').appendTo('#tmpDiv ')

请提供有用的建议..

4

1 回答 1

1

尝试

var select = $('#allocationId').find('select');
select.clone().appendTo('#tmpDiv,#modalDiv');

你也缺少一个结束</select>标签

演示

于 2012-08-24T08:53:11.050 回答